      <title>Battering a driveway edge?</title>
      <link>https://community.graphisoft.com/t5/Modeling/Battering-a-driveway-edge/m-p/111918#M59149</link>
      <description>&lt;DIV class="actalk-migrated-content"&gt;&lt;T&gt;I have a driveway cut into a hillside and would like to batter the edges, the batter is only about a meter deep, so a 1.5 meter wide batter would do. The slope of the drive coming down the hill is about 15deg. The hillside is a mesh and the drive is a roof slab.&lt;/T&gt;&lt;/DIV&gt;</description>

      <description>You could add points to the mesh and modify their elevations, or use another roof above your driveway, on a layer that is normally turned off, with sloping sides (angled fascia) and use Solid Element Operation subtraction.&lt;BR /&gt;
